WebWater backup coverage has a set limit (typically from $5,000 to $7,000), and is not a part of your main dwelling coverage. Depending on the amount of water backup coverage you … WebFlood coverage is generally excluded on the basic homeowners policy. However, some homeowners policies provide coverage for backup of sewers and drains that cause flooding in your basement. You should check with your agent to see if this coverage is provided and how much it costs.
